Paley's Place was a special restaurant located in Portland, Oregon. It was known for serving delicious food from the Pacific Northwest. This means they used fresh, local ingredients from the region.
The restaurant was found in a beautiful old Victorian house. This house was along Northwest 21st Avenue in Portland's Northwest District.
About Paley's Place
Paley's Place was started in 1995. A chef named Vitaly Paley and his wife, Kimberly Paley, opened it together. It was a cozy place to eat, often called a "bistro-style eatery." A bistro is a small, informal restaurant.
People thought Paley's Place was a fancy and nice restaurant. It was a popular spot for many years in Portland.
What Happened to Paley's Place?
Paley's Place closed its doors in 2021. After serving the community for over 25 years, the restaurant stopped operating. It remains a memorable part of Portland's food history.
